Spring Boot texnologiyaları (Security, Data JPA, Messaging, Autoconfiguration, Beans, profiles)
Yeni microservis-lərin yazılması, mövcud servislərdə təkmilləşdirmə işləri (ms- migration, ms-commission, ...)
Yeni və mövcud servislər üçün dokumentasiyaların hazırlanması, lazım olduqda ortaq əməkdaşlıq etdiyimiz təşkilatlara ötürülməsi
PostgreSQL məlumat bazası, DataGrip, DBeaver vǝ Docker Desktop kimi vasitələrlə məlumat bazasına qoşulma, saxlanan məlumatlar üzərində Əməliyyatların aparılması və analizi
Git vǝ GitLab-la tanışlıq, edilən dəyişikliklərin repo-lara göndərilməsi və prosesi izləyərək merge request-lərlə əsas reliz branç-lara birləştirilməsi
CI-CD pipeline-larla və Docker image-lərlə tanışlıq, dəyişikliklərin fərqli mühitlərə reliz olunması və prosesin izlənməsi qaydaları
AWS-də müxtəlif servislərdən istifadə qaydaları (CloudWatch və Kibana ilə logların monitorinqi, S3-də müxtəlif faylların saxlanılması, EKS-də servislərin test və real mühitlərdə reliz olunması)
Xüsusi tələblər:
Alqoritmik və analitik düşünmə qabiliyyəti
Proqramlaşdırma dillərindən (Java, Kotlin, Python, C#) ən az biri üzrə təməl biliklər
OOP və prinsipləri haqqında məlumatlı olmaq
JEE vǝ Spring (Spring Boot) freymvork təməl bilikləri
Mikroservis və monolit arxitekturası üzrə təməl biliklər
Məlumat bazası (PostgreSQL, Oracle) və NoSql (MongoDB) üzrə təməl biliklər